And I do think that the 6th and 12th Doctors have a lot in common character-wise.
This exchange between the Doctor and Peri could have just as easily been between the Doctor and Clara -
The Doctor: Ahhh... a noble brow. Clear gaze. At least it will be given a few hours sleep. A firm mouth. A face beaming with a vast intelligence. My dear child what on Earth are you complaining about? It's the most extraordinary improvement.
Peri: Improvement?! On what?!
The Doctor: My last incarnation... oh, I was never happy with that one. It had a sort of feckless "charm" which simply wasn't me
Peri: What absolute rubbish! You were almost young, and you were sweet.
The Doctor: "Sweet?!" Effete! Sweet? Sweet? That says it all. No, this has been a timely change... Change? What change? There is no change... no time, no rhyme, no place for space, nothing! Nothing but the grinding engines of the universe, the crushing boredom of eternity!

I think Eccleston was really the only actor in the role who didn't have some relationship with the show, at least since the original series days (eg William Hartnell is said to have claimed the only actor whom could possibly replace him was Patrick Troughton, and Troughton recalled the BBC constantly coming at him with better and better offers until he could not refuse, despite feeling he was not right for the role).
